Start your day at Hyde Park, one of London's largest and most famous parks. Enjoy a leisurely morning stroll among its beautiful landscapes, visit the Serpentine Lake, and discover the exquisite Diana Memorial Fountain. Cost: Free admission. Recommended time: 2 hours.
Head west to Kew Gardens, a UNESCO World Heritage Site known for its botanical collections and stunning glasshouses. Explore the various themed gardens, including the iconic Palm House and the Waterlily House. Cost: £18 per adult. Recommended time: 3 hours.
Take a relaxing boat trip or walk along the tranquil canals of Little Venice. Admire the charming houseboats, tree-lined paths, and peaceful atmosphere. Stop for a delightful canal-side lunch at one of the cozy cafes or floating restaurants. Cost: Boat trips from £10 per person. Recommended time: 2 hours.
End your day by exploring Hampstead Heath, a vast green oasis in North London. Enjoy panoramic views of the city from Parliament Hill, have a picnic by one of the ponds, or take a peaceful walk through the ancient woodlands. Cost: Free admission. Recommended time: 2 hours.
If you have some extra time, consider visiting Primrose Hill, a quaint neighborhood with a picturesque hill offering stunning views of London's skyline. Another hidden gem is Queen Elizabeth Olympic Park, where you can relive the spirit of the 2012 Olympics and enjoy scenic walks along the river.
